Old school balance of fruit, acidity and tannins, a little dominanted by the acidity, attractive white pepper and sage spices, chaming cassis and pomegrante fruit, earthy charm. This is a 2nd wine that I often enjoy, but it is a little overly marked by the vintage here. Score: 86 Jane Anson, Inside Bordeaux Maturity: 2025-2038 02 April 2024 |

The 2021 Meyney comes across as severe in feel, light and unusually compact. Cedar, mint, spice, iron and white pepper struggle to emerge. This needs more mid-palate depth and more of a delicate hand. Score: 89 Antonio Galloni, Inside Bordeaux Maturity: 2024-2033 27 February 2024 |

The 2021 Meyney, which has been on a strong run of form of late, has a lovely bouquet with vivid red berry fruit, crushed stone and orange rind scents that are focused and lively. The palate is medium-bodied with a structured opening (as you would expect), more fruit concentration than its peers and a truffle-tinged finish. This will cruise nicely over the next 15 to 20 years. Score: 92 Neal Martin, Vinous.com Maturity: 2028-2045 22 February 2024 |

Cask sample. Excellent depth of flavour and ripeness. Sappy with no skinniness. Really no sign that this was a difficult vintage. Complete. Fresh with ripe tannins dominated by vibrant, ripe fruit. It even has some impressive persistence. It’s not super-ripe but is certainly ripe enough. Score: 17 Jancis Robinson MW, JancisRobinson.com Maturity: 2027-2042 06 May 2022 |

A pretty wine with currant, cherry and some spices, such as nutmeg. Subtle this year. Medium body. Score: 91 - 92 James Suckling, JamesSuckling.com 01 May 2022 |

Offering up aromas of cassis, blackberries, spices and creamy new oak, the 2021 Meyney is medium to full-bodied, ample and fleshy, with lively acids, powdery tannins and an impressively rich, textural profile for the vintage. It's a blend of 54% Cabernet Sauvignon, 34% Merlot and 12% Petit Verdot. Score: 89 - 91 William Kelley, Wine Advocate, RobertParker.com 29 April 2022 |
